Group of likeminded individuals, pooling Rs. 1K per month to feed the needy, elderly and sick people .
2. What does GHuGs provide?
Providing a food kit for the destitute families, once in a month .
3. Where the project does take place?
Currently in the suburbs of Trivandrum district.
4. What are the criteria for participation?
A charity mind to willfully donate Rs 1000 per month without fail.
5. What arrangements should the project partner make?
Once a beneficiary is provided with a food kit they need to be provided every month. The donation should be made by 10th of every month or make a fixed deposit in your name and make arrangements to transfer the interest (Rs. 1000) to the NGGFn account .
6. What benefits does the project partner gain?
Satisfaction of involving in a regular charity to feed the needy. Income Tax deduction as per 80G certificate and government norms.
